Sr Staff Engineer, Analog Design About GlobalFoundries GlobalFoundries is a leading full-service semiconductor foundry providing a unique combination of design, development, and fabrication services to some of the world’s most inspired technology companies. With a global manufacturing footprint spanning three continents, GlobalFoundries makes possible the technologies and systems that transform industries and give customers the power to shape their markets. For more information, visit www.gf.com.

Key Responsibilities Design and develop key analog and mixed-signal IP blocks such as: Amplifiers (op-amps, instrumentation amps) Comparators Data converters (SAR, delta-sigma, pipeline familiarity) Bandgap references and regulators (LDO, DC-DC basics) Monitoring circuits (POR, power-valuable, etc.) Contribute to architecture discussions and design tradeoff analysis with senior team members Perform transistor-level schematic design, simulation, and verification using industry-standard EDA tools Analyze circuit performance across PVT conditions including: Corner simulations Monte Carlo mismatch analysis Noise and reliability considerations Work closely with layout engineers to ensure parasitic-aware design and performance closure Support and contribute to design reviews and verification planning Participate in silicon bring-up, validation, and debugging activities Collaborate across disciplines including layout, verification, and SoC integration teams Generate clear documentation for design specifications, simulations,



and validation results Other Responsibilities Perform all activities in a safe and responsible manner and support Environmental, Health, Safety & Security requirements and programs Mentorship of junior design/layout engineers in design best practices and effective collaboration Required Qualifications Bachelor’s or master’s degree in electrical engineering or related field 10-15 years of experience in analog or mixed-signal IC design.

Solid understanding of analog design fundamentals: Device operation, biasing, gain, bandwidth Stability and compensation Noise, mismatch, and process variation Experience with transistor-level design and simulation in CMOS technologies Familiarity with industry-standard EDA tools (Cadence Virtuoso, Spectre, etc.) Ability to run and analyze simulations across PVT and variability conditions Strong analytical and debugging skills Basic scripting skills (Python, MATLAB, or similar) are a plus Good communication and documentation skills Ability to work effectively in cross-functional, global teams Preferred Qualifications Experience designing one or more analog blocks from spec to simulation (partial or full ownership) Exposure to silicon validation and lab debugging Familiarity with layout concepts and parasitic effects Experience with low-power design techniques Exposure to advanced nodes such as Bulk CMOS, FDSOI, or FinFET Experience contributing to tape out or silicon-proven designs Information about our benefits you can find here: https://gf.com/about-us/careers/opportunities-asia Experience Level Senior Level
